Indications of the Hour

Ultimately, the Shia teachings on the Hour reveal a multifaceted understanding of divine justice, communal responsibility, and spiritual fervor. They challenge adherents to embrace a vision of the future that transcends mere passivity. Instead, the promising vision of al-Mahdi’s return beckons believers to cultivate a life steeped in righteousness—one that actively contributes to the broader quest for justice and transformation.

In conclusion, the concept of the Hour within Shia theology embodies profound implications not only for individual believers but also for collective society. It beckons a transformative approach to ethics, morality, and communal engagement, initiating a profound shift in perspective that can inspire both the faithful and the broader community towards building a just and compassionate world.
